2. Choose the Right Cultivation Container
The container for a lotus plant should be made of a material with good breathability and drainage, such as ceramic or plastic. The size of the container should be moderate, not too large or too small.
3. Pay Attention to Sunlight
The lotus enjoys sunlight and should be placed in a sunny area. During the hot summer, be sure to provide some shade to avoid leaf damage from direct sunlight.
4. Fertilize Properly
Lotus plants need moderate fertilization during their growing period. You can choose special aquatic plant fertilizers and follow the instructions for application. Over-fertilizing can cause yellowing leaves and poor growth.
5. Maintain Clean Water Quality
Aquatic plants are easily affected by water pollution, so it is important to maintain clean water quality. Regularly change part of the water and use a special aquarium cleaner to clean the container.
